Full Job Description
As a Graduate Quantitative Researcher, you will work with experienced researchers and developers in a fast-paced, data-driven environment. You will learn how trading ideas are researched, tested, and deployed, while contributing to live strategy development from early in your career.
Your Core Responsibilities:
- Research and test data-driven trading ideas
- Analyse large and complex datasets from cryptocurrency exchanges, DeFi protocols, and financial markets
- Build, test, and improve models, signals, and algorithms that support trading strategies
- Work with IMCs cutting-edge data, software, and high-performance computing infrastructure
- Collaborate closely with researchers, developers, and engineers to turn research into production-ready strategies
- Learn how to evaluate trading opportunities with a focus on performance, scalability, robustness, and risk
Your Skills and Experience:
- Final-year student or recent graduate in Mathematics, Statistics, Physics, Computer Science, Engineering or a related quantitative field
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to learn quickly
- Programming experience, ideally in Python. Familiarity with C++ is a plus
- A genuine interest in financial markets, trading, crypto, or DeFi
- Comfortable working with data and applying quantitative methods to real-world problems
- Curious, collaborative, and eager to take ownership in a fast-moving environment
Prior experience in trading, crypto, or financial markets is helpful but not required.
This is an on-site role based in Zug, Switzerland, with very limited flexibility for working from home.
About Us
IMC is a global trading firm powered by a cutting-edge research environment and a world-class technology backbone. Since 1989, weve been a stabilizing force in financial markets, providing essential liquidity upon which market participants depend. Across our offices in the US, Europe, Asia Pacific, and India, our talented quant researchers, engineers, traders, and business operations professionals are united by our uniquely collaborative, high-performance culture, and our commitment to giving back. From entering dynamic new markets to embracing disruptive technologies, and from developing an innovative research environment to diversifying our trading strategies, we dare to continuously innovate and collaborate to succeed.
